Project in Tiburon
Project in Tiburon
Julie Williams DesignJulie Williams Design
Family room adjacent to kitchen. Paint color on fireplace mantel is Benjamin Moore #1568 Quarry Rock. The trim is Benjamin Moore OC-21. The bookcases are prefinished by the cabinet manufacturer, white with a pewter glaze. Designed by Julie Williams Design, Photo by Eric Rorer Photgraphy, Justin Construction

Colorful & Cozy in Chappaqua NY
Colorful & Cozy in Chappaqua NY
Amazing SpacesAmazing Spaces
This project incorporated the main floor of the home. The existing kitchen was narrow and dated, and closed off from the rest of the common spaces. The client’s wish list included opening up the space to combine the dining room and kitchen, create a more functional entry foyer, and update the dark sunporch to be more inviting. The concept resulted in swapping the kitchen and dining area, creating a perfect flow from the entry through to the sunporch. A double-sided stone-clad fireplace divides the great room and sunporch, highlighting the new vaulted ceiling. The old wood paneling on the walls was removed and reclaimed wood beams were added to the ceiling. The single door to the patio was replaced with a double door. New furniture and accessories in shades of blue and gray is at home in this bright and airy family room.
